To find the sum of \( \frac{9}{100}+\frac{7}{10} \), first, you need a common denominator. Since \( 10 \) can be expressed as \( \frac{10}{100} \), you can rewrite \( \frac{7}{10} \) as \( \frac{70}{100} \). Now you have \( \frac{9}{100} + \frac{70}{100} = \frac{79}{100} \). So, the sum is \( \frac{79}{100} \) or \( 0.79 \) in decimal form! One trick to remember is that when adding fractions, always look for that common denominator first! It's a key step to making things easier and preventing mistakes.
